PERB has recognized that it is an unfair practice for an employer to prosecute a baseless lawsuit with the intent of retaliating against employees for their exercise of protected rights. In these cases, the lawsuit must be both objectively baseless and subjectively motivated by an unlawful purpose. more or view all topics or full text.

Adverse actions (denial of merit salary adjustment, bad evaluation, refusal to alter work assignment, and imposition of involuntary disability leave) against an employee were taken because of dissatisfaction with her (employee's) work, displeasure with her resistance to accepting directions and criticism from supervisors, and the desire of the supervisors to conduct the program according to their own judgments. Adverse actions were not due to Charging Party invoking aid of union. more or view all topics or full text.
